  • Q1. What is otdr
  • Ans. 

    OTDR stands for Optical Time Domain Reflectometer. It is a device used to measure the characteristics of an optical fiber.

    • OTDR is commonly used in the telecommunications industry to troubleshoot and maintain fiber optic networks.

    • It sends a series of light pulses into the fiber and measures the time and intensity of the reflections to determine the length, loss, and quality of the fiber.

  • Q1. Where is the fiber broken and how will you fix it?
  • Ans. 

    To determine the location of a broken fiber, I would use an OTDR and then fix it by splicing or replacing the damaged section.

    • Use an Optical Time Domain Reflectometer (OTDR) to analyze the fiber and locate the break.

    • Once the break is identified, the damaged section can be spliced back together or replaced.

    • Splicing involves fusing the two ends of the fiber together using a fusion splicer.
